gobble calls?
 
Do the shaker gobble calls really work? Or is that just another thing that works sometimes and doesnt the other? The purpose is to get the turkey to gobble right?

r33h 05-09-2008 07:59 AM

RE: gobble calls?
 
I have had luck with it in the past. Sometimes, when I have a gobbler that is gobbling his head off at me and is on the other side of a group of trees waiting for the "hen" to come to him, shake the gobble shaker and he starts to get a little more fired up and impatient because he thinks there is now another gobbler around.

I have a friend that lives in Washington (I am in Texas) who I consider to be one of the best turkeys hunters I know and he uses the shaker quite a bit, sometimes even as a locator-type call. I have tried it a couple of times in this manner, but I don't have near as much luck.

On an importance scale of 1 to 10, I would give the call a 3. I don't use it a whole lot, but it can work. One thing to remember, everytime you use the call, you might be attracting every hunter around your area because you are making a gobbling sound...so use the call with caution.

My experience has been the same as r33h's. I've had gobblers hang up and I've used a gobble to convince them that the competition is moving in. Only I just use a box call by holding it upside down with a rubber band around it. Shaking it make a pretty good jake gobble. Like all calls, it's not always going to seal the deal, but it's another tool.
